Formulas Name : Ling Sheng San

Chinese Name : 灵圣散

Drug Formulation

Tiannanxing (raw, coarsely chopped), Fangfeng (stem removed, coarsely chopped).

Source

Quoted from *Collected Effective Prescriptions for Infant Care* in *The Great Compendium of the Yongle Era*, Volume 1036.

Processing

Grind the above ingredients into a fine powder.

Benefits

For open wounds caused by rabid dog bites in adults and children, as well as wounds from dog bites.

Instructions for Use

First, wash the wound with a decoction made from whey, scallion whites, and locust tree branches; apply the mixture to the wound while still wet. Cover with the ointment mentioned above twice daily.
